httpURLConnection 大文件上传(setFixedLengthStreamingMode)
httpURLConnection 默认是缓存缓存所有的输出流数据,然后封装成一条http发出。所以很容易崩溃。
http://blog.csdn.net/phantomes/article/details/19606455
文件上传思路
直接的输出流。(httpURLConnection 会缓存所有的数据,然后一次发出,只适合小文件)
固定大小(setFixedLengthStreamingMode)
大文件
直接的输出流。(httpURLConnection 会缓存所有的数据,然后一次发出,只适合小文件)(文件分割,多个http请求)
固定大小(setFixedLengthStreamingMode)
相关推荐
支持多文件上传,大文件上传,带有进度条,Java语言,用到DWR
使用plupload上传大文件,改下配置可以上传G级文件。已经过实测,可以上传G级文件,直接导入myeclipse中就可以使用。后台使用java改写的。花了一上午的时间,要你6分不亏!
java大文件上传至ftp服务器带进度条显示的,进度条的显示和ftp的上传速度同步,解决了进度条显示和ftp不同步的问题
文件上传一直是B/S结构中很重要的一项功能,在java中并没有很好的实现文件上传的类包,因此出现了一些开源的组件,Smartupload ,commons-fileupload,还有国内的一个"牛人"的(不好意思叫不上名字来),这几个组件中...
java实现大文件上传并有进度条及其代码解析
完整的java大文件分块上传支持断点续传,包含jar包,可以直接导入eclipse使用。
利用字节数组将大文件进行拆分,并把每一小块数据封装成对象进行传输,然后在接收端进行数据块的组装,生成传输文件。
java实现的大文件上传,支持断点续传 支持分片分片上传 采用springboot框架是实现
java毕业设计——java文件传输系统的设计与实现(论文+源代码).zip java毕业设计——java文件传输系统的设计与实现(论文+源代码).zip java毕业设计——java文件传输系统的设计与实现(论文+源代码).zip java毕业设计...
java 大文件 传输 源码,socket tcp
利用java图形化界面和网络编程相结合实现的--文件上传。 运行步骤: (1)分别运行工程两个包中的两个.java文件(UploadClient.java和UploadServer.java)分别会弹出“上传客服端”和“上传服务器”两个窗口。 ...
如何利用 Java 实现 QQ 文件传输功能 现在, 通过网络传输文件已经非常普遍, 各种传输工 具也很多, 最具有代表性的就是 QQ 提供的文件传输功能了, 它能让好友之间方便的把自己的文件传给对方。 仔细查看 QQ 的...
java文件异步上传
java多文件上传实现,上传界面采用flash,同时显示上传进度条
java上传文件到服务器,将本地的文件上传到服务器上去
(1)分别运行工程两个包中的两个.java文件(UploadClient.java和UploadServer.java)分别会弹出“上传客服端”和“上传服务器”两个窗口。 (2)单击“上传服务器”窗口中的“启动服务..”按钮。 (3)单击“上传...
1GB以内的任何文档、图片、视频、Flash文件和音频文件都可以多文件无刷新批量上传。